Comedian, writer, actress, and podcast host Whitney Cummings is bringing her stand-up to Grand Falls Casino and Golf Resort in Larchwood, Iowa in April.

Cummings is on stage at Grand Falls, Saturday, April 29, at 8:00 PM.

Tickets start at $40 and are on sale now.

Cummings was born and raised in the Washington DC area.

After graduating from the University of Pennsylvania in 2004, Cummings moved to Los Angeles where she began her career as a stand-up comedian.

By 2007, she was named one of '10 Comics to Watch' by Variety. That same year she began appearing as a regular guest on the E! series Chelsea Lately, and was a regular on the show until it ended in 2014.

In 2008, she was named one of '12 Rising Stars of Comedy' by Entertainment Weekly.

In August 2010, her first one-hour special, titled Whitney Cummings: Money Shot, premiered on Comedy Central.

In 2011, she co-created the CBS sitcom 2 Broke Girls while she also starred in the NBC sitcom Whitney, which she created and executive produced.

Cummings published her first book, I'm Fine...And Other Lies, a collection of personal stories about her life, in 2017.

Since 2019, Cummings has hosted her own podcast, Good For You, where she interviews friends, fellow comics, and celebrities.

The comedy duo of Williams and Ree will open the Grand Falls show.

The two have been performing together for more than 50 years, after first crossing paths as students at Black Hills State in Spearfish, back in 1968.
